Output 23acfe4d2d9ca272aee54b8f1b64d76124c64e55a8bceb8a2dab1fcff6862fe4:4

value
40738611
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22a778437e4304626efc411d9b93fb87f64b7ec8 OP_EQUAL
address
MB4PpxSfEgB54zHAPYfwXHPYhxP9vpzMqN
transaction
23acfe4d2d9ca272aee54b8f1b64d76124c64e55a8bceb8a2dab1fcff6862fe4
spent
true